Bollywood’s primary ideological project has been the reinforcement of the joint family and the nation-state as sacred entities. In the post-Independence era, films like Mother India (1957) explicitly allegorized the nation as a suffering mother, whose sacrifice and moral rectitude legitimize the modern Indian state. The entertainment derives from watching this matriarch overcome adversity without abandoning her dharma (duty). desimasala xxx

The economic liberalization of India in the 1990s shifted focus toward glamorous, family-oriented romantic dramas targeted at the Non-Resident Indian (NRI) diaspora. Actors like Shah Rukh Khan, Aamir Khan, and Salman Khan (the "Three Khans") dominated this era with blockbusters like Dilwale Dulhania Le Jayenge . Bollywood cinema, a term that has become synonymous with Indian cinema, has been a significant part of the country's entertainment industry for decades. The term "Bollywood" is a blend of Bombay (the former name of Mumbai) and Hollywood, coined to describe the Indian film industry's attempt to replicate the grandeur and success of American cinema. Over the years, Bollywood has evolved into a global phenomenon, entertaining audiences not only in India but across the world. For global audiences, "Bollywood" (a portmanteau of Bombay and Hollywood) conjures images of vibrant saris, improbable dance sequences in the Swiss Alps, and three-hour-long narratives punctuated by melodramatic plot twists. Academically, however, the Mumbai-based Hindi film industry represents one of the most potent and enduring popular culture phenomena of the postcolonial world. Producing over 1,000 films annually, Bollywood commands a domestic and diasporic audience of billions. The central thesis of this paper is that Bollywood’s distinctive mode of entertainment is not an artistic failure to achieve Western realism, but rather a deliberate and functional aesthetic. This paper will first dissect the structural elements of Bollywood’s entertainment formula. Second, it will analyze how these elements perform ideological work regarding gender, family, and nation. Finally, it will discuss Bollywood’s evolution as a tool of Indian soft power in the 21st century.
